Our verdict is Uncertain significance. The variant received 1 ACMG points: 1P and 0B. PP3

The NM_017906.3(PAK1IP1):​c.376G>T​(p.Val126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000161 in 1,613,996 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

PAK1IP1 (HGNC:20882): (PAK1 interacting protein 1) Involved in regulation of signal transduction by p53 class mediator and ribosomal large subunit biogenesis. Located in nucleolus. [provided by Alliance of Genome Resources, Apr 2022]

The c.376G>T (p.V126L) alteration is located in exon 4 (coding exon 4) of the PAK1IP1 gene. This alteration results from a G to T substitution at nucleotide position 376, causing the valine (V) at amino acid position 126 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
